Nebraska Weekly Livestock Auction Summary

Mon Oct 13, 2025
USDA Livestock, Poultry & Grain Market News · Federal-State Market News Service, Kearney, NE (LS-WH)
Receipts 27,573Last week 23,975Year ago 35,753

Compared to last week, steer calves less than 600 lbs sold 20.00 higher. Over 600 lbs sold steady to 8.00 higher. Most heifer calves sold 20.00 higher, except 5 weights sold 5.00 higher. Yearlings sold 4.00 to 7.00 higher. Demand was good to very good throughout the week. Unbelievable is the best way to describe the market this month. Who would have thought the fall cash market would outsell most of the summer video sales and the prices this summer were bell ringers, record breakers! Some of the lightweight calves are headed to the Southern Plains that will be turned out on wheat or some type of winter grazing. Even the feedlots saw a nice upward swing in the cash market. Might have been better if the CME cattle boards didn't fall off due to AI driven sell offs on Friday. Dressed sales sold 10.00 higher at 372.00 and live sales sold 5.00 to 6.00 higher at 240.00.
